WebThe pinewood nematode (Bursaphelenchus xylophilus) is the most destructive pest of forest and landscape pines in Japan. This nematode invades the stems and branches of pines causing a sudden wilting and death of the tree regardless of its age or size. Bursaphelenchus xylophilus (Pinewood nematode, PWN) is one of the most destructive organisms in the global forest ecosystem with multipath spreading, serious harm, the wide adaptation area, and the high difficulty of treatment. More than 50 countries in the world list it as a quarantine object (Manuel and Mota, 2008).
